How To Develop A Website From Scratch

Websites are an essential part of our lives. Undoubtedly, they have turned our lives easier and faster than ever before. It helps to offer next-generation digital experiences to the users. In the business world, websites have turned as an asset and to stay in the market for entities it is important to launch their own online platform. However, websites offer several advantages to the organization as it helps to increase your online presence and also increase your revenue. Presently, website development services are not only confined to coding and basic features but now it is something next to creativity.

Developers have to focus on coding and know about the predominant features in the industry. Apart from this, they have to focus on many other things such as an easily searchable domain, essential features, and easy payment gateway. In order to leverage all the benefits of website development, partner with a web app development company

In this blog, let’s know the proper strategy to develop your website from scratch. 

Steps to develop your website from scratch

1. Research and Analysis 

Before developing your website, it is necessary to research the market in a better way. Know your goals in a better way and strategies of your competitors that how they are working in the market and offering their customers. This is how you can get the idea to plan your strategies in an effective manner. Research and analysis have been considered as the foremost step of the website development process, which helps you to be successful. 

2. Target your Audience 

After researching your market, it is important to know your audience, so you can target them with effective marketing strategies. Your audience can be anyone they can be customers or wholesalers, and for production. Knowing your targeted audience will help you to meet their expectations and this is how you can know what they want and need, which will help you to plan the strategy in that way. This is how you can meet your customer requirements. 

3. Easy Searchable Domain 

Now the next step of website development is you should opt for the easily searchable domain. The domain should be short and concise. Apart from this, it should be easy to read and understandable. Domain should match with your company brand or reflect your service as it will help your users to reach you easily without any hassle. Don’t opt for the long or confusing domain. 

4. Focus on Features 

Functionalities in your website play a huge role in website development. The proper features integrated in the website play an important role as through them only you will be providing them the experience of your services. Make sure that your website should be based on user-friendly attributes and it should be easy to use and along with this, you should focus on the latest website trends such as latest technologies should be integrated – voice recognition, virtual assistance, and deals and offers. 

5. Focus on User Interface

The user interface plays an important role in the website development process. With an interactive user interface, developers can attract the users, they should focus on delivering highly appealing customized design, which allows them to increase customer satisfaction. 

Designing plays an important role as the dull interface can lead to losing the interest of the customers and they can opt for another platform. The user interface can attract the customers for a longer duration to the websites. Designers should focus on the attractive icons, and add essential elements in the website, that ensures to deliver high user experiences and customer satisfaction. 

6. Tools 

To boost the development process, there are several tools available in the market. In order to leverage the benefits of several tools and technologies, developers should know about the several features of the tools for different functionalities. However, tools exclude repetitive actions from the development process and allow developers to focus on the creative aspects.  In order to stay ahead in the market, it is important that a developer should know about the different functionalities of the tools. 

7. Automated Testing 

Developers should prefer the automated testing process. There are different tools, which allows detailed, repetitive, and data-intensive tests automatically. It increases the quality of the software and offers robust and high performance to the developers. However, different frameworks are also a part of the automated testing, which helps to test the software in a proper way and record the results of them. The best benefit of the testing tools is that they provide instant and browser response to the action.


Website development is not an easy task, developers have to focus on several other attributes of the development process. These are the different aspects on which developers should focus on.

Previous Post
Next Post